New, Free SAE International Virtual Symposium Explores Trends in Systems Engineering


WARRENDALE, Pa. – WEBWIRE

SAE International offers a free, virtual symposium that explores the latest trends impacting today’s systems engineering teams and provides the latest knowledge, insight, and solutions so professionals can respond and adapt to changes, internally and externally, while delivering market-leading products.

The “2014 Continuous Engineering Virtual Symposium: Cutting-Edge Approach to Systems Engineering,” is hosted by IBM and will be held live and online from 8 a.m.-5 p.m. (EDT) on Thursday, Sept. 4, 2014.

The symposium gives attendees the opportunity to interact with experts in an online environment that includes a Virtual Theater featuring three hour-long technical panel discussions, a Virtual Speaker Room showcasing eight 20-minute speaker sessions, an Exhibit Hall with customized booths, and a Resource Center containing downloadable white papers and demos. Theater Presentations and Speaker Sessions are presented by Danlaw, Elektrobit, Intertek, and River North Solutions.

Participants will be able to:

·         Learn about the challenges and capabilities associated with smarter product development

·         Explore the concept of continuous engineering through real-world experiences

·         Hear about potential roadblocks to success and how to overcome them

·         See how continuous engineering can help increase product development competitiveness

·         Gather real-world advice by chatting live with industry experts

SAE International is a global association committed to being the ultimate knowledge source for the engineering profession. By uniting more than 145,000 engineers and technical experts, we drive knowledge and expertise across a broad spectrum of industries. We act on two priorities: encouraging a lifetime of learning for mobility engineering professionals and setting the standards for industry engineering. We strive for a better world through the work of our philanthropic SAE Foundation, including programs like A World in Motion® and the Collegiate Design Series™.
